Subject: [PATCH v5 06/10] drivers,cxl: Use node-notifier instead of memory-notifier
Date: Thu, 5 Jun 2025 16:22:57 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20250605142305.244465-7-osalvador@suse.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250605142305.244465-1-osalvador@suse.de>
memory-tier is only concerned when a numa node changes its memory state,
specifically when a numa node with memory comes into play for the first
time, because it needs to get its performance attributes to build a proper
demotion chain.
So stop using the memory notifier and use the new numa node notifer
instead.

diff --git a/drivers/cxl/core/region.c b/drivers/cxl/core/region.c
index c3f4dc244df7..a8477a3e175c 100644
--- a/drivers/cxl/core/region.c
+++ b/drivers/cxl/core/region.c
@@ -2432,12 +2432,12 @@ static int cxl_region_perf_attrs_callback(struct notifier_block *nb,
unsigned long action, void *arg)
{
struct cxl_region *cxlr = container_of(nb, struct cxl_region,
- memory_notifier);
- struct memory_notify *mnb = arg;
- int nid = mnb->status_change_nid;
+ node_notifier);
+ struct node_notify *mnb = arg;
+ int nid = mnb->nid;
int region_nid;
- if (nid == NUMA_NO_NODE || action != MEM_ONLINE)
+ if (nid == NUMA_NO_NODE || action != NODE_ADDED_FIRST_MEMORY)
return NOTIFY_DONE;
/*
@@ -3484,7 +3484,7 @@ static void shutdown_notifiers(void *_cxlr)
{
struct cxl_region *cxlr = _cxlr;
- unregister_memory_notifier(&cxlr->memory_notifier);
+ unregister_node_notifier(&cxlr->node_notifier);
unregister_mt_adistance_algorithm(&cxlr->adist_notifier);
}
@@ -3523,9 +3523,9 @@ static int cxl_region_probe(struct device *dev)
if (rc)
return rc;
- cxlr->memory_notifier.notifier_call = cxl_region_perf_attrs_callback;
- cxlr->memory_notifier.priority = CXL_CALLBACK_PRI;
- register_memory_notifier(&cxlr->memory_notifier);
+ cxlr->node_notifier.notifier_call = cxl_region_perf_attrs_callback;
+ cxlr->node_notifier.priority = CXL_CALLBACK_PRI;
+ register_node_notifier(&cxlr->node_notifier);
cxlr->adist_notifier.notifier_call = cxl_region_calculate_adistance;
cxlr->adist_notifier.priority = 100;
diff --git a/drivers/cxl/cxl.h b/drivers/cxl/cxl.h
index a9ab46eb0610..48ac02dee881 100644
--- a/drivers/cxl/cxl.h
+++ b/drivers/cxl/cxl.h
@@ -513,7 +513,7 @@ enum cxl_partition_mode {
* @flags: Region state flags
* @params: active + config params for the region
* @coord: QoS access coordinates for the region
- * @memory_notifier: notifier for setting the access coordinates to node
+ * @node_notifier: notifier for setting the access coordinates to node
* @adist_notifier: notifier for calculating the abstract distance of node
*/
struct cxl_region {
@@ -526,7 +526,7 @@ struct cxl_region {
unsigned long flags;
struct cxl_region_params params;
struct access_coordinate coord[ACCESS_COORDINATE_MAX];
- struct notifier_block memory_notifier;
+ struct notifier_block node_notifier;
struct notifier_block adist_notifier;
};
